陳莞華


您好,我結業於資展國際(資策會教研所)的智慧應用微軟C#訓練專班,經過585小時的強化學習,掌握了微軟 .NET 網站開發的專業知識。在培訓期間,透過實際專案進一步錘鍊了技術能力,並為未來的工作打下了堅實的基礎。

  • 基本資料
  • 電子郵件:[email protected]
  • 連絡電話:0983-401-104
  • 應徵職缺:C#工程師

 技能(資展國際-智慧應用微軟C#訓練專班 585小時)

後端

  • C#
  • ADO.NET
  • ASP.NET Core MVC
  • RESTful API
  • LINQ

前端

  • Angular+TypeScript
  • Ajax
  • HTML+CSS
  • Bootstrap
  • JavaScript

資料庫

  • Transact-SQL
  • Microsoft SQL Server

其他

  • .NET MAUI
  • Power BI
  • Azure AI
  • Git & GitHub

 工作經歷

  • 資安人員   基隆市政府教育處  (2019年4月至2024年6月)

  1. 協助基隆市政府取得ISO 27001資通安全認證。
  2. 113年申請數位發展部競爭型之資訊應用實施計畫,補助基隆市政府「校務行政系統重建及優化」,總經費共2,925,000元整。
  3. 108-109年執行「基隆市教育網路中心綠能雲端資料中心暨資源向上集中實施計畫」,總經費共15,116,000 元整。 
  • 行政人員   德育護理健康學院

                      (2017年3月至 2019年3月)

  •  網路編輯   民視新聞  (2016年6月至2017年2月)

     - 協助「民視新聞網」網站畫面設計。


 學歷


  學士 國立彰化師範大學

        資訊管理系-數位內容與科技管理組                                              (2012-2015)

碩士 國立臺灣科技大學              數位學習與教育研究所(就讀中)

 證照


  • 資安專業證照:

     ISO 27001:2022 主導稽核員

  • Adobe Photoshop CS5


 語言


  • 多益 TOEIC 金色證書(865分)


 專案

WinForm專案-衣貳衫後台管理系統

在WinForm專案中,除了運用預存程序實作資料庫的CRUD功能,為了確保資料操作的安全性,使用了SqlParameter防止SQL Injection攻擊,並在刪除會員時透過try-catch捕捉錯誤,確保系統能夠正確處理會員仍有訂單的情況。

ASP.NET Core MVC + Angular 專案

-衣貳衫購物平台

在本專案中,運用Entity Framework Core進行資料存取,減少了大量的資料庫語法編寫。且網站前台使用 Angular前端框架,結合Restful API 和 JWT 達到網站會員的驗證功能,後台管理員密碼則使用 MD5 加密提高了安全性。

自 傳

【轉職契機:從資安到系統開發】

        在擔任資安人員期間,我負責對委外廠商進行資安稽核,並在過程中發現受稽廠商竟以明碼儲存使用者的帳號和密碼,這一安全漏洞讓我深刻意識到,雖然制定規範和定期稽核能在一定程度上保障系統安全,但要根本杜絕資安問題,開發階段的安全設計才是關鍵。於是,我決定參加資展國際的智慧應用微軟C#訓練專班,經過585小時系統化地學習C#、ASP.NET Core等開發技術,不僅掌握了開發技能,更將資安知識融入系統設計,從源頭提高系統的安全性。

【專案成果:技術實踐與應用】

 在資展國際的智慧應用微軟C#專班受訓期間,我完成了兩個重要的專案:WinForm及MVC專案。 

  • WinForm專案:
  • 除了運用預存程序達成資料庫的CRUD功能外,亦實作幾項功能,包含隨機產生會員個人邀請碼、透過INNER JOIN查詢會員之間的好友關係。另外,為了確保資料操作的安全性,使用SqlParameter防止SQL Injection攻擊。在處理「刪除會員」時,藉由try-catch捕捉相關錯誤,確保系統能夠正確處理會員仍有訂單的情況,並向使用者提供明確的錯誤提示。
  • MVC專案:
  • 應用Entity Framework Core進行資料存取,藉由其易用性和可擴充性顯著提升開發效率,此外,並導入JWT技術,以確保網站會員身份驗證的安全性。後台管理系統則使用AuthorizationHandler<TRequirement>工具來管控頁面的存取權限,管理員的身份驗證及密碼儲存均採用MD5加密技術,進一步保障資料的機密性。

【團隊合作與溝通:跨部門協作與問題解決】

        在過去的工作經驗中,團隊合作和溝通一直是我工作的核心。在基隆市政府教育處擔任資安人員期間,通過頻繁的跨部門協作與溝通,確保資訊安全管理規範的實施,最終順利協助單位取得ISO 27001資通安全認證。另外,在執行「基隆市教育網路中心綠能雲端資料中心暨資源向上集中實施計畫」過程中,察覺機房溫度異常過低時,主動調查並發現是「感測器位置錯誤」所致,經過調整後成功將PUE值降至1.6以下,以符合綠能雲端資料中心的標準。

        這些經歷突顯了我在團隊合作中的溝通能力和遇到問題時的獨立解決能力,同時展現我勇於面對困難而不退縮的工作態度,確保各項專案能持續並順利地執行。

【未來期望與發展:技術精進與職業成長】

        在接下來的職業生涯中,我將持續專注於學習新技術,特別是敏捷式開發和三層式架構(Repository Pattern),這些技術能有效提升開發效率和系統的可維護性。通過不斷精進技術,能在快速變化的技術領域中保持競爭力,並為未來的挑戰做好充分準備。同時,計劃將過去在資安領域的經驗融入開發工作中,以進一步提升系統的安全性和穩健性。憑藉這些努力,期望能在未來建立自律、好學和勇於挑戰的基石,不斷推動自我成長與專業發展。